Abstract

The utility model provides a cutting device for a foamed aluminum-plastic panel, and belongs to the technical field of cutting equipment. The cutting device for the foamed aluminum-plastic panel comprises a cutting assembly, a discharging conveying assembly and a feeding conveying assembly. An air cylinder is installed over the cutting bearing plate, the cylinder rod end of the air cylinder is fixedly connected with a connector, the top end of the cutting knife is fixedly connected with an insertion block, the insertion block is inserted into the connector, and the insertion block and the connector are jointly provided with a connecting bolt in a threaded connection mode. The feeding conveying assembly is installed at the feeding end of the cutting bearing plate, and through cooperation of a connector, an inserting block and a connecting bolt, a cutting knife can be detached and replaced, so that the cutting knife can be replaced or polished, the cutting knife is kept sharp, cracks are avoided when the foaming aluminum-plastic panel is cut, and the cutting efficiency is improved. And the quality and the appearance of the foamed aluminum-plastic panel are not influenced.

[0001] This application relates to the field of cutting equipment, and more specifically, to a cutting device for foamed aluminum composite panels. Background Technology

[0002] Aluminum composite panels (also known as aluminum composite boards) are a new type of decorative material. Since being introduced to China from Germany in the late 1980s and early 1990s, they have quickly gained popularity due to their economy, variety of colors, convenient construction methods, excellent processing performance, superb fire resistance, and high quality.

[0003] The unique properties of aluminum composite panels determine their wide range of applications: they can be used for building exterior walls, curtain wall panels, renovation of old buildings, interior wall and ceiling decoration, advertising signs, display stands, and cleanroom dust control projects. It is a new type of building decoration material.

[0004] During the production process, foamed boards need to be cut into different sizes and thicknesses to meet usage requirements. This requires a foamed board cutting device to cut the foamed boards. For example, a foamed board cutting device disclosed in Chinese application No. 202320015848.6 can cut foamed aluminum composite panels. However, in this application, the cutting blade and the driving component are fixedly connected. After long-term use, the cutting blade will wear down and become less sharp. A dull cutting blade will cause cracks when cutting foamed aluminum composite panels, thus affecting the appearance and quality of the foamed aluminum composite panels. Utility Model Content

[0005] To overcome the above shortcomings, this application provides a cutting device for foamed aluminum composite panels, which aims to improve the problem that the cutting blade will wear down after long-term use and become less sharp. A dull cutting blade will cause cracks when cutting foamed aluminum composite panels, thus affecting the appearance and quality of the foamed aluminum composite panels.

Detailed Implementation

[0026] The technical solutions in the embodiments of this application will now be described with reference to the accompanying drawings.

[0027] Please see Figures 1-6 This application provides a cutting device for foamed aluminum composite panels, including a cutting assembly 10, an output conveying assembly 20, and an input conveying assembly 30. The specific structures of the output conveying assembly 20 and the input conveying assembly 30 adopt existing structures and will not be described in detail here.

[0028] Please see Figure 1 , Figure 2 , Figure 3 , Figure 4 , Figure 5 and Figure 6The cutting assembly 10 includes a cutting support plate 110 and a cutting blade 140. A bracket is installed at the bottom of the cutting support plate 110, and a mounting bracket 120 is installed on the bracket. A cylinder 130 is installed on the mounting bracket 120. A cutting groove is formed on the cutting support plate 110. The cylinder 130 is installed directly above the cutting support plate 110. A connector 160 is fixedly connected to the cylinder rod end of the cylinder 130. An insert block 170 is fixedly connected to the top of the cutting blade 140. The insert block 170 is inserted into the connector 160. A connecting bolt 180 is screwed onto both the insert block 170 and the connector 160. Specifically, both the connector 160 and the insert block 170 have threaded grooves that mate with the connecting bolt 180. The discharge conveying assembly 20 is installed at the discharge end of the cutting support plate 110. The feed conveying assembly 30 is installed at the feed end of the cutting support plate 110. When the cutting blade 140 becomes dull after prolonged use, the connecting bolt 180 is removed from the connector 160 and the insert block 170, thereby detaching the cutting blade 140 from the cylinder 130. The cutting blade 140 can then be sharpened or replaced. During installation, the insert block 170 is inserted into the connector 160, and then the connecting bolt 180 is screwed on for fixation. The cooperation of the connector 160, insert block 170, and connecting bolt 180 allows for the disassembly and replacement of the cutting blade 140, enabling its sharpening or replacement and ensuring it remains sharp. This prevents cracking during cutting of foamed aluminum composite panels, thus preserving the quality and appearance of the panels.

[0029] In this embodiment, auxiliary connectors 150 are also provided on both sides of the connector 160, and the two auxiliary connectors 150 are detachably connected to the cutting blade 140. The auxiliary connector 150 includes a connecting rod 153, the top end of the connecting rod 153 is fixedly connected to the outside of the connector 160, and the bottom end of the connecting rod 153 is fixedly connected to a U-shaped locking block 151. Both sides of the U-shaped locking block 151 are provided with elastic abutment portions 152, and the two elastic abutment portions 152 abut against both sides of the cutting blade 140. The elastic abutment portion 152 includes a limiting block 1521, the limiting block 1521 is fixedly connected to a guide rod 1522, the other end of the guide rod 1522 movably passes through the side wall of the U-shaped locking block 151 and is fixedly connected to a locking block 1523, and a locking spring 1524 is sleeved on the outside of the guide rod 1522 between the locking block 1523 and the U-shaped locking block 151. The cutting blade 140 has a retaining groove 141 on its side that mates with the retaining block 1523. When installing the cutting blade 140, it is first secured inside the two retaining blocks 1523 to pre-fix it before installation. The cooperation between the retaining spring 1524 and the retaining blocks 1523 makes the cutting blade 140 more stable when cutting foamed aluminum composite panels. Furthermore, no additional personnel are needed to support it during installation; one person can complete the installation.

[0030] Please see Figure 1 and Figure 2 An item placement assembly 40 is provided inside the cutting support plate 110 and the feeding conveyor assembly 30 adjacent to each other. The item placement assembly 40 includes an item placement box 410, which is located inside the cutting support plate 110 and the feeding conveyor assembly 30. The item placement box 410 contains a respirator and protective equipment. An installation plate 420 is fixedly connected inside the cutting support plate 110 and the feeding conveyor assembly 30, and the item placement box 410 is mounted on the installation plate 420. Since toxic gases, mainly carbon tetrachloride and benzene, are generated during the cutting of foamed aluminum composite panels, these gases volatilize during the cutting process and are harmful to human health. Therefore, workers can take out protective equipment from inside the item placement box 410 for daily protection. The item placement box 410 provides a storage area for protective items.
